Configures and personalizes your Claude Code Colab environment through interactive setup and automated notebook modification.
This skill streamlines the setup of Claude Code Colab by tailoring the development environment to your specific project needs. It features an interactive interview mode to determine your primary use case—such as ML training or data analysis—and then automatically generates customized CLAUDE.md files, slash commands, and configuration settings. By directly modifying the bootstrap notebook template, it allows you to pre-install dependencies, set default project types, and analyze existing notebooks to align the AI's behavior with your existing workflows and architectural patterns.
